Course structure

• Incident Response Plan • Incident Containment • Forensic Analysis • Malware Analysis • Network Traffic Analysis • Incident Reporting • Incident Recovery • Legal and Ethical Considerations • Incident Response Team Coordination • Incident Communication and Public Relations
